Transaction dff6426acceb21c84a0c2650eb77728532ff3177f89390590658a55c5fe41e58
1 Input
1 Output
-
dff6426acceb21c84a0c2650eb77728532ff3177f89390590658a55c5fe41e58:0
- value
- 2289689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fd63cdce1c941975a59852565ab13e028a1b473 OP_EQUAL
- address
- 3DLxPQV7unf3aasfqEy2KQUuRV7NQkKmNW